\n\nThe Truth Behind 'Vet Approved': What It Does—and Doesn’t—Mean
\n'Vet approved' is not a regulated term. Unlike FDA approval for drugs or CPSC certification for children’s toys, no federal body oversees or verifies this claim on pet products. A 2024 investigation by the Pet Product Safety Coalition found that 78% of products labeled 'veterinarian recommended' or 'vet approved' had never been reviewed by a single licensed DVM—and worse, 31% contained materials flagged by the ASPCA Animal Poison Control Center (APCC) as high-risk for cats, including phthalate-laden PVC plastics and nickel-coated metal components.
\nSo when you ask what car kitt knight rider vet approved, what you’re really asking is: Which specific Knight Rider–inspired cat products have undergone real-world testing by credentialed veterinarians for ocular safety, ingestion risk, noise sensitivity, and thermal regulation? The answer requires digging past marketing copy into clinical observation data—not packaging slogans.

Frequently Asked Questions
\nIs there any official 'vet-approved' certification program for pet products?
\nNo—there is no government or industry-wide certification called 'vet approved.' The closest legitimate standard is the AAHA (American Animal Hospital Association) Pet Product Safety Seal, which requires third-party lab testing AND review by a licensed DVM. Only 12 products carried this seal in 2024. Always verify the seal links to AAHA’s public database—not just a logo on packaging.
\nCan my regular veterinarian evaluate a 'Knight Rider' cat product for me?
\nYes—but request a material safety consult, not just a general opinion. Bring the product’s ingredient disclosure sheet (if available) and ask specifically: 'Does this contain ortho-phthalates, heavy metals, or VOC-emitting polymers? Is the LED spectrum safe for chronic feline exposure?' Most general-practice vets won’t know spectral data offhand, but they can cross-check against APCC and AVMA toxicology bulletins—or refer you to a veterinary toxicologist.

\nAre 'Knight Rider' themes inherently unsafe for cats?
\nNo—the theme itself isn’t dangerous. What’s dangerous is the common design shortcuts taken to achieve the look: cheap reflective coatings, noisy motors, cramped cockpits, and brittle plastics. Safe versions exist—but they prioritize feline biology over cinematic accuracy. Think matte-black non-reflective surfaces, silent magnetic drive systems, and open cockpit architecture.
\nHow often should I replace automotive-themed cat toys?
\nEvery 6 months—even if intact. UV exposure degrades plastics, increasing VOC leaching. Chewing accelerates micro-fractures where bacteria and toxins accumulate. Replace immediately if you detect a 'chemical' smell (like new sneakers or vinyl shower curtains), discoloration, or stiffness in flexible parts.
